In Drap, an apartment sells for €3,227/m² on average and a house for €4,122/m² in 2025. Over five years, prices moved by +6.0% for apartments and +6.3% for houses.

Average price per m² in Drap by year, apartments and houses
YearApartmentsHouses
2014€2,780/m²€3,454/m²
2015€2,844/m²€3,371/m²
2016€2,889/m²€3,538/m²
2017€2,871/m²€3,694/m²
2018€2,854/m²€3,776/m²
2019€2,884/m²€3,887/m²
2020€3,044/m²€3,878/m²
2021€3,173/m²€4,188/m²
2022€3,285/m²€4,497/m²
2023€3,253/m²€4,198/m²
2024€3,117/m²€4,080/m²
2025€3,227/m²€4,122/m²

The average rent of an apartment in Drap is 14.7 €/m² per month, a gross yield of 5.5% at the average purchase price.

Drap has 1,689 dwellings, 55.7% of them apartments. Studios and two-room flats make up 11.1% of the stock, and 28.5% of households rent their main home.

Timeline: G in 2025, F in 2028, E in 2034. A lever for negotiation and value after renovation.

6.7% of dwellings are rated E, F or G and affected by the progressive rental ban, including 2.2% rated F or G.

Drap has 5,238 inhabitants, a median age of 39 and a density of 953 inhabitants per km².

The median annual household income is €29,962, with an unemployment rate of 14.8%.
